Transaction 862b04e91eb82b4b156f526071e156f3a89cc1e6cbfd4f6c24544cf5c8654eac

967 Input
2 Outputs
  • 862b04e91eb82b4b156f526071e156f3a89cc1e6cbfd4f6c24544cf5c8654eac:0
  • value  5970144208
    address  3EKWP3ZviLXudcoAfzammYQKwaz2zJKwQW
  • 862b04e91eb82b4b156f526071e156f3a89cc1e6cbfd4f6c24544cf5c8654eac:1
  • value  171818
    address  bc1q0qfzuge7vr5s2xkczrjkccmxemlyyn8mhx298v